There are several options for getting from Ullapool to Dunfermline by bus, train and car. The cheapest option is to take the bus and then take the train which costs around £39 ($46) and will take around 4h 30m. If you need to get there more quickly, you can drive and arrive in approximately 3h 40m, though it is a bit more costly at approximately £55 ($65).
The distance between Ullapool and Dunfermline is around 316km (196 miles). In a direct line (as the crow flies), the distance is 228km (141 miles)
It takes around 4h 50m to get from Ullapool and Dunfermline by bus. If you are travelling by car it will take around 3h 40m to drive there.
The quickest way to get from Ullapool to Dunfermline is to drive which takes around 3h 40m and will set you back approx £55 ($65).
The cheapest way to travel between Ullapool and Dunfermline, if you exclude driving, is to take the bus and then take the train which will typically cost around £39 ($46) for a standard one-way ticket.
There is no train service that runs between Ullapool and Dunfermline. We recommend that you drive to Dunfermline. instead which will take 3h 40m.
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Ullapool and Dunfermline. It typically takes around 4h 50m and departs twice daily.
There are no direct bus services that runs from Ullapool to Dunfermline. However, you can instead can take several connecting buses with changeovers in Inverness Bus Station Stance 3 and Halbeath Park & Ride. These services run twice daily and will take a minimum of 4h 50m.
Scottish Citylink and Megabus UK run regular bus services between Ullapool and Dunfermline. Buses run twice daily and take around 4h 50m on average but will vary depending on you book with.
It doesn't look like you can fly directly from Ullapool to Dunfermline. We recommend that you take the bus to Inverness Bus Station Stance 3 and then to Halbeath Park & Ride. instead which will take 4h 50m.
The closest major airport to Dunfermline is Edinburgh Airport (EDI) (EDI) which is approximately 15km (9 miles) from Dunfermline. Dundee Airport (DND) (DND) and Glasgow Airport (GLA) (GLA) are also nearby and might be a better alternative airport depending on where you are flying from.
Yes it is possible to drive from Ullapool and Dunfermline. The distance is around 316km (196 miles) by road and it will take around 3h 40m in normal traffic conditons.
If you don't have a car, the easiest way to get from Ullapool to Dunfermline is to take the bus which takes, on average, 4h 50m and will usually cost around £41 ($49).
